The Trump administration's strategy regarding the Strait of Hormuz has been characterized by rapid shifts and a lack of clear communication. The initial announcement of 'Project Freedom' on social media caught key allies off guard, leading to a suspension of the operation after Saudi Arabia denied the U.S. military access to its airspace. This exposed a lack of coordination and planning within the administration.
Throughout the conflict, President Trump has alternated between signaling a desire for de-escalation and issuing threats of military action. This inconsistent messaging has been attributed to Trump's tendency to make off-the-cuff statements that then become policy, leaving aides to clarify and explain. The economic consequences of the instability in the Strait of Hormuz are significant, with rising fuel prices adding pressure on the administration ahead of midterm elections.
Efforts to secure international support for reopening the strait have also been complicated by Trump's rhetoric, with some allies hesitant to become militarily involved. Despite the challenges, diplomatic efforts continue, with Pakistan acting as a mediator between the U.S. and Iran. The situation remains fluid, with the potential for further escalation or a negotiated resolution.
